Default How do you remove the EGR valve in a 96 5.8?

I have 96 E150 club wagon with the 5.8L engine. How do you remove the EGR valve? Whats the best way to get to the back bolt?

Its been a while since I last did one of those. Its a stinker , but be careful they are rusted in pretty well. Soak it first with Liq wrench or bb blaster. Wd 40 is not that good.
The large nut on the bottom if I recall correctly is difficult to get at also. Patience pays.

Thanks for the advice. Fortunately I didn't have to remove it. It turned out to be a bad EGR feedback sensor. I replaced the sensor and now she runs fine.
